‘Eventually these stigmas won’t exist’

One man's crusade to help people with dementia has seen dozens inspired in his hometown, thanks to a special workshop, aimed at educating people on the signs of dementia.

Rick Deller's lives were turned upside down, when his dad was diagnosed with the condition at the age of 65. The councillor's mission was to invite the likes of cafes, shops, charities, restaurants, volunteers - anyone who works in a public setting - to attend special seminars, helping them to spot the signs of people with dementia and how to behave around them.

Tom Edwards reports from the first of what will be many workshops, in Droitwich.
